问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

基于Spring Boot的城市公交查询系统

创作时间:
作者:
@小白创作中心

基于Spring Boot的城市公交查询系统

引用
CSDN
1.
https://blog.csdn.net/m0_73395273/article/details/144980338

随着城市化进程的加快和人口的持续增长,城市公共交通系统面临着前所未有的挑战。传统的公交查询方式存在信息更新不及时、查询不便等问题,这不仅增加了市民出行的时间成本,也降低了公交系统的运行效率。因此,开发一个高效、便捷的城市公交查询系统显得尤为重要。基于Spring Boot的城市公交查询系统应运而生,它利用现代信息技术手段,为市民提供实时、准确的公交出行信息服务,有助于优化公交服务,提高公交系统的运行效率和服务质量,缓解城市交通压力,促进绿色出行。

技术架构与特点

  • 后端:采用Spring Boot框架,结合MyBatis等持久层框架,实现数据的持久化和业务逻辑的处理。Spring Boot以其简化配置、独立运行的特点,为快速开发和部署提供了便利。

  • 前端:使用Vue.js等前端框架,结合HTML5、CSS3、JavaScript等技术,构建了响应式、用户友好的界面。前端负责与用户进行交互,提供直观的操作界面和丰富的功能选项。

  • 数据库:采用MySQL等关系型数据库管理系统,用于存储公交线路、站点、车辆实时位置等数据。数据库的设计和优化确保了数据的高效访问和存储。

  • 系统特点

  • 实时性:系统能够实时获取公交车辆的位置信息,为用户提供准确的到站预测和换乘建议。

  • 智能化:利用算法对公交数据进行挖掘和分析,提供个性化的线路规划和推荐服务。

  • 用户友好:界面设计简洁明了,操作流程简单易懂,降低了使用难度。

  • 可扩展性:系统采用模块化设计,支持快速开发新功能,满足城市公交系统不断变化的需求。

核心功能模块

  • 实时公交查询:用户可以通过输入公交线路号或站点名,查询实时公交车辆的位置信息、预计到站时间等。

  • 线路规划:系统能够根据用户的起点和终点,提供多种换乘方案,并展示详细的线路图和站点信息。

  • 车辆到站预测:基于实时公交数据,系统能够预测车辆到达指定站点的时间,帮助用户合理安排出行计划。

  • 用户互动:提供在线留言功能,用户可以在此提出意见或反馈问题,与管理员进行沟通。

  • 管理员功能:管理员可以登录系统后台,对公交线路、站点、车辆等信息进行管理和维护。

应用场景与优势

  • 应用场景

  • 适用于各类城市公交系统,为市民提供便捷的公交查询服务。

  • 可用于公交公司的信息化管理,提高公交资源的利用率和服务质量。

  • 系统优势

  • 提高出行效率:通过实时公交查询和线路规划功能,帮助用户快速找到最优出行方案,减少等待时间。

  • 优化公交服务:系统能够收集和分析用户出行数据,为公交公司提供优化公交线路设置的建议。

  • 增强用户体验:智能化的线路规划和推荐服务,以及用户友好的界面设计,提高了用户的使用体验。

  • 促进智慧城市建设:作为城市交通管理和规划的重要工具,该系统有助于推动智慧城市的建设进程。



综上所述,基于Spring Boot的城市公交查询系统是一个功能全面、高效便捷、用户友好的智能化服务平台。它不仅能够满足市民对公交出行信息的即时获取需求,还能够为公交公司提供信息化的管理解决方案,有助于优化城市交通结构,提高出行效率和服务质量。

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号